feat:-优化员工工作量统计

This commit is contained in:
shijing 2025-11-11 13:51:36 +08:00
parent 1a68fb56d8
commit cf0088c515
1 changed files with 14 additions and 11 deletions

View File

@ -3,19 +3,21 @@
<el-header>
<div class="left-panel"></div>
<div class="right-panel">
<!-- <el-cascader
v-model="query.dept_name"
:options="group"
:props="groupsProps"
clearable
:show-all-levels="false"
@change="deptChange">
</el-cascader> -->
<el-input v-model="query.user_name"
<xtSelect
:apiObj="apiObj"
v-model="query.user_name"
:valueField="'name'"
:labelField="'name'"
v-model:label="query.user_name"
style="width:150px; margin-right: 5px;"
>
<el-table-column label="姓名" prop="name"></el-table-column>
</xtSelect>
<!-- <el-input v-model="query.user_name"
placeholder="姓名"
clearable
style="width: 200px;"
></el-input>
></el-input> -->
<el-date-picker
v-model="query.start_date"
type="date"
@ -72,7 +74,7 @@ export default {
return {
query:{
end_date:'',
dept_name:'',
user_name:'',
start_date:'',
},
mgroups: [],
@ -84,6 +86,7 @@ export default {
checkStrictly: true,
project_code : this.$TOOL.data.get("BASE_INFO").base.base_code
},
apiObj: this.$API.system.user.list,
};
},
mounted() {